RBC 2012

Short description

The RBC is a series of biennial symposia intended to bring together biophysics researchers from Austria, Croatia, Hungary, Italy, Serbia, Slovenia and Slovakia, and also includes internationally renowned guest speakers. The conference will take place on September 3-7, 2012 in Kladovo, Serbia.

Event date – September 3-7, 2012
Venue – Kladovo, Serbia

Description

The first RBC meeting took place in March 2005 in Terme Zrece (Slovenia), the second one was held in August 2007 in Balatonfüred (Hungary), the third one in February 2009 in Linz (Austria), and the fourth one in September 2010 in Primošten (Croatia). The principal aims of the conference are: 1) to strengthen the collaborative ties between biophysics groups in the region, 2) to present the cutting-edge achievements from a broad range of biophysics disciplines to students and 3) to promote the field of biophysics. Following previous conferences, RBC 2012 will feature a combination of top level senior researchers and aspiring young scientists (postdoctoral fellows and graduate students) from the above countries. The conference language is English.
